Templar Building

  • Profile: Templar Building is a Building Construction company located at Devonport, Tasmania Australia, address is 6 Ambleside Place, Devonport 7310 TAS, postcode is 7310
Google Map of Templar Building address: 6 Ambleside Place, Devonport 7310 TAS.

Map And Street View

Please note that location of this property on map is approximate and street view images may not show the exact property advertised.
Please share as much information as you can about Templar Building so other users can benefit from your comment.

Related Businesses

Templar Roofing Pty. Ltd.

Templar Roofing Pty. Ltd.

Nearby Businesses

Sunrise Motor Inn

Sunrise Motor Inn

Luxury Oz Stays

Luxury Oz Stays

Birchwood Devonport self contained Accommodation

Birchwood Devonport self contained Accommodation

Baptcare Karingal Community

Baptcare Karingal Community

Meercroft Care INC.

Meercroft Care INC.

A & B Automotive

A & B Automotive

Latrobe Auto & 4x4

Latrobe Auto & 4x4

Midas

Midas

Shaws Auto Centre

Shaws Auto Centre

Cummins

Cummins